Common Causes of Motorcycle Accidents in West Englewood, IL

Motorcycle accidents often occur due to various factors, including:

  • Distracted Driving: Drivers using mobile phones or other distractions fail to see motorcycles.
  • Speeding: Excessive speeds reduce reaction times and increase accident severity.
  • Failure to Yield: Many accidents happen when drivers fail to yield at intersections.
  • Drunk or Impaired Driving: Alcohol and drug use impair reaction times and judgment.
  • Poor Road Conditions: Potholes, debris, and road construction can be hazardous for motorcyclists.
  • Unsafe Lane Changes: Drivers who fail to check blind spots often collide with motorcycles.

Common Motorcycle Accident Injuries in West Englewood, IL

Motorcycle crashes often lead to severe injuries, such as:

  • Traumatic Brain Injuries (TBI): Even with helmets, head injuries can be life-altering.
  • Spinal Cord Injuries: Can cause paralysis or long-term disability.
  • Broken Bones & Fractures: Common in high-impact crashes.
  • Road Rash & Soft Tissue Damage: Severe abrasions can lead to infections and scarring.

Types of Common Motorcycle Accidents

Motorcycle accidents occur in different ways, including:

  • Head-On Collisions: Often fatal and caused by reckless driving.
  • Left-Turn Accidents: When vehicles turn left without noticing an oncoming motorcycle.
  • Lane Splitting Accidents: Occur when motorcyclists ride between lanes of slow-moving traffic.
  • Rear-End Collisions: Can throw a motorcyclist off their bike upon impact.
  • Single-Vehicle Crashes: Result from road hazards, weather conditions, or mechanical failures.

Compensation for Motorcycle Accident Victims in West Englewood, IL

If you’ve been injured in a motorcycle accident, you may be eligible for compensation, including:

  • Medical Expenses: Covers hospital bills, surgeries, and rehabilitation.
  • Lost Wages: Reimbursement for time off work due to injuries.
  • Pain and Suffering: Compensation for physical pain and emotional distress.
  • Property Damage: Covers motorcycle repairs or replacement.
  • Punitive Damages: Available in cases of extreme negligence.

FAQ Section

1. How long do I have to file a motorcycle accident claim in Illinois?

You have two years from the date of the accident to file a personal injury lawsuit in Illinois. Consult a lawyer to ensure timely filing.

2. Can I still receive compensation if I was partially at fault?

Yes, Illinois follows a comparative negligence rule, meaning you can recover damages if you are less than 50% at fault.

3. What if the driver who hit me was uninsured?

You may be eligible for compensation through u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age from your own insurance policy.

4. How much is my motorcycle accident case worth?

The value depends on factors like medical bills, lost wages, pain and suffering, and liability. An attorney can provide an estimate after reviewing your case.
